Job description
Responsibilities
  • Lead and manage the structural engineering design from project commencement though to completion
  • Lead technical workshops with relevant consultants and internal supply chain, monitor tasks to ensure they are closed out
  • Coordinate with multidisciplinary teams including architecture, geotechnical, façade and MEP
  • Plan and implement innovative solutions contributing to safe systems of work
  • Plan the construction activities and prepare an information release schedule to ensure the timely supply of construction information
  • Ensure timely and accurate completion of drawings to comply with project requirements
  • Report any blockers or late information to the relevant stakeholders
  • Ensure designs such as temporary works are code compliant and incorporated with the permanent works
  • Provide technical support during construction, including site inspections and solutions for NCRs
  • Review and comment on specialist subcontractor information where necessary
  • Prepare technical reports and submittals

About the Company

Spearheading the JRL Group from the outset J Reddington Ltd have been an industry leading groundwork and concrete frame specialist for over two decades. Building on a proven track record to date, the company is now increasingly being called upon to deliver solutions on large projects in London and the South East. We are looking to recruit a design manager with responsibility for the concrete frame and ground works elements of the JRL Group projects based in Borehamwood.
